GDDY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

774 of the 7,595 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in GoDaddy (GDDY)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$24B — down 3.3% from $24.8B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 118 funds opened new GDDY positions and 76 closed out — a net gain of 42 holders — while 285 added to existing stakes and 296 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$242M. The largest seller was Capital International Investors, cutting an estimated $439M.
